About the role:

The Lead Product Manager at Builder.io will work directly with the CEO to drive our core platform strategy and execution. You'll own our Publish (CMS) product, the foundation of our platform, while helping shape our broader visual development ecosystem. 

This role combines strategic product leadership with deep technical expertise—you'll drive product decisions and roadmap priorities while having the technical depth to make customer impacting technical decisions alongside engineering. Your strong foundation in modern frontend development, especially with frameworks like React, will be crucial for evolving both our core CMS capabilities and our emerging visual development tools.

As a Lead Product Manager at Builder.io, you will:

  • Own and drive the product strategy for our core Publish (CMS) platform, from vision through execution

  • Partner with the CEO to shape our broader platform strategy and translate it into detailed roadmaps

  • Lead the evolution of our developer experience, including our APIs, SDKs, and integration frameworks

  • Drive improvements to our onboarding experience and documentation, making our platform more accessible to developers and content teams alike

  • Conduct user research and gather feedback from both technical and non-technical users to inform product decisions

  • Work cross-functionally with design, engineering, and customer success to deliver cohesive product experiences

  • Define and track key metrics for both developer adoption and content team usage

You will thrive in this role if you have...

  • Experience leading successful developer-focused products, particularly in the CMS, frontend tooling, or developer platforms space

  • Strong technical background with deep understanding of modern frontend development (React, TypeScript, APIs, build tools)

  • A proven track record of shipping features that serve both technical and non-technical users

  • Experience improving developer onboarding, documentation, and integration experiences

  • Strong product intuition and ability to balance technical excellence with user needs

  • A track record of working effectively with engineering teams and driving technical consensus

  • Experience gathering and synthesizing feedback from diverse user groups
